Skultuna Messingsbruk, often just called Skultuna, is one of Sweden’s oldest industrial companies — in fact, one of the oldest still active manufacturers in the world. It was founded in 1607 by King Karl IX. The location for the factory was chosen carefully: it is in Skultuna, near Västerås, where the brook Svartån provides water power, there was access to raw materials (copper from the mine at Falun), and ample wood for charcoal. From the start, the foundry made things like brass plates, candlesticks, chandeliers, combining craft and design. Georg Jensen Exceedingly rare Georg Jensen Monumental "Dolphin" 830 Silver Candelabra No. 224 Designed in 1919, made of 830 silver of the period. This pair was made and with date marks of 1920 making within one year of the original design. These seldom come to market and very few were ever made. Also note the rich patina and superb details. The design features two 3-Dimensional dolphins with entwined tails in the center, blossom-like 3-D detailing, beading, woven detail, and more. Museum quality. Works of art.
